Councils urged to go faster on grants

By Martin Ford | 26 January 2022

Council chief executives have been urged by the Government to go faster in distributing COVID-19 grants.

Business secretary Kwasi Kwarteng has written to all local authorities to stress that firms affected by the pandemic were depending on funds administered by councils for their survival.
